The primary responsibilities of the security officer are: Implementing and maintaining the ship security plan, Conducting security inspections at regular intervals to ensure that proper security steps are taken. From a first-hand perspective on a carrier, it is important to keep in mind that there are several commands aboard when the ship is underway, and many of the people are in multiple org charts: The ship itself has a CO, XO, Command Master Chief (CMC), and Department Heads (DHs) aboard, The Carrier Strike Group has a CO, XO, CMC, and DHs aboard, Every air wing has a CO, XO, CMC, and DHs aboard. .
